Information Shared With Third Parties

KICA will not sell, give or generally make available Personal Information to members or outside agencies. Occasionally, the association may release members’ contact information to a neighbor, or to island officials for important business. Please note that the contact information for all KICA committee members, or volunteer group members, is available to other members of that committee or group for communicating with each other.

KICA may disclose Personal Information to third parties with which the Association contracts to conduct its essential functions, such as gate access, election administration, email communications, and the listserv, for the express purposes of Association business.
